[AUTO-BUG-SUP] Bug Hunt Status (Cycle 3) #7449

Closed
opened 2026-04-10 19:38:52 +00:00 by HAL9000 · 1 comment
Owner

Bug Hunt Pool Supervisor — Cycle 3 Status

Started: 2026-04-10 (after 120s sleep following Cycle 2)
Modules Under Scan: application/services/ (deeper scan), repo_indexing, cleanup_service

Cumulative Results (Cycles 1-3)

16 bugs filed total across all cycles:

By Severity

Priority Count
Critical/High 10
Medium 6

By Category

Category Count
Concurrency 6
Security 4
Data integrity / data-flow 4
Resource management 3

All Filed Issues

Cycle 1 (12 bugs)

  • #7406 Critical: LockService TOCTOU race — expired lock replacement not atomic
  • #7407 Medium: LockService ISO string timestamp comparison fragility
  • #7408 Critical: PromptSanitizer injection bypass via Unicode homoglyphs
  • #7409 Critical: ReactiveEventBus thread safety gap — subscriptions dict
  • #7411 Critical: SessionService duplicate message sequences under concurrency
  • #7412 Medium: GitWorktreeSandbox resource leak after failed merge
  • #7415 Medium: config/security_scanner false positives on Jinja2 templates
  • #7416 Medium: GraphExecutor infinite loop in _follow_chained_edges()
  • #7418 Critical: PluginLoader.validate_protocol() executes untrusted constructor code
  • #7420 Medium: MEMORY_ENGINES global cache race condition
  • #7423 Critical: file_tools.validate_path() string prefix allows sibling directory traversal
  • #7424 Critical: PlanLifecycleService in-memory cache staleness across processes

Cycle 2 (3 bugs)

  • #7436 Critical: McpClient double-start race condition in _ensure_started()
  • #7437 Medium: CostTracker daily costs dict grows unboundedly
  • #7443 Medium: CleanupService permanently caches sandbox directory list

Cycle 3 (1 bug so far)

  • #7445 Medium: RepoIndexingService._resource_locks grows unboundedly

Next Actions

Continuing scan of remaining modules:

  • context_service
  • a2a/
  • lsp/
  • actor/
  • domain models deep scan

Automated by CleverAgents Bot
Supervisor: Bug Detection Pool | Agent: bug-hunt-pool-supervisor

## Bug Hunt Pool Supervisor — Cycle 3 Status **Started**: 2026-04-10 (after 120s sleep following Cycle 2) **Modules Under Scan**: application/services/ (deeper scan), repo_indexing, cleanup_service ## Cumulative Results (Cycles 1-3) **16 bugs filed total** across all cycles: ### By Severity | Priority | Count | |----------|-------| | Critical/High | 10 | | Medium | 6 | ### By Category | Category | Count | |----------|-------| | Concurrency | 6 | | Security | 4 | | Data integrity / data-flow | 4 | | Resource management | 3 | ## All Filed Issues ### Cycle 1 (12 bugs) - #7406 **Critical**: LockService TOCTOU race — expired lock replacement not atomic - #7407 Medium: LockService ISO string timestamp comparison fragility - #7408 **Critical**: PromptSanitizer injection bypass via Unicode homoglyphs - #7409 **Critical**: ReactiveEventBus thread safety gap — subscriptions dict - #7411 **Critical**: SessionService duplicate message sequences under concurrency - #7412 Medium: GitWorktreeSandbox resource leak after failed merge - #7415 Medium: config/security_scanner false positives on Jinja2 templates - #7416 Medium: GraphExecutor infinite loop in _follow_chained_edges() - #7418 **Critical**: PluginLoader.validate_protocol() executes untrusted constructor code - #7420 Medium: MEMORY_ENGINES global cache race condition - #7423 **Critical**: file_tools.validate_path() string prefix allows sibling directory traversal - #7424 **Critical**: PlanLifecycleService in-memory cache staleness across processes ### Cycle 2 (3 bugs) - #7436 **Critical**: McpClient double-start race condition in _ensure_started() - #7437 Medium: CostTracker daily costs dict grows unboundedly - #7443 Medium: CleanupService permanently caches sandbox directory list ### Cycle 3 (1 bug so far) - #7445 Medium: RepoIndexingService._resource_locks grows unboundedly ## Next Actions Continuing scan of remaining modules: - context_service - a2a/ - lsp/ - actor/ - domain models deep scan --- **Automated by CleverAgents Bot** Supervisor: Bug Detection Pool | Agent: bug-hunt-pool-supervisor
Author
Owner

Closing stale duplicate — superseded by newer tracking issue #7531.


Automated by CleverAgents Bot
Supervisor: System Watchdog | Agent: system-watchdog-pool-supervisor

Closing stale duplicate — superseded by newer tracking issue #7531. --- **Automated by CleverAgents Bot** Supervisor: System Watchdog | Agent: system-watchdog-pool-supervisor
Sign in to join this conversation.
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
cleveragents/cleveragents-core#7449
No description provided.